"Hochelaga, Land of Souls" is a 2017 Canadian historical drama film directed by François Girard. The film explores the history of Montreal, Quebec, through a series of interconnected narratives spanning over 750 years. It delves into pivotal moments in Montreal's history, including encounters between Indigenous peoples and European settlers, the impact of colonization, and the cultural diversity that shapes the city's identity. "Open Range" is a western film directed by Kevin Costner, released in 2003. The story is set in the American Old West during the late 1800s and follows the journey of two free grazers, Charley Waite (Kevin Costner) and Boss Spearman (Robert Duvall), who roam the open range with their cattle. The peaceful life of Waite and Spearman takes a dramatic turn when they encounter hostile rancher Denton Baxter (Michael Gambon) and his hired guns. Movie guide with answer key and a couple pre-vocabulary,On Nov. 4, 1979, militants storm the U.S. embassy in Tehran, Iran, taking 66 American hostages. Amid the chaos, six Americans manage to slip away and find refuge with the Canadian ambassador. Knowing that it's just a matter of time before the refugees are found and likely executed, the U.S. government calls on extractor Tony Mendez (Ben Affleck) to rescue them. "Our People Will Be Healed" is a documentary film directed by acclaimed Canadian filmmaker Alanis Obomsawin, released in 2017. The film provides an optimistic and uplifting look at the Helen Betty Osborne Ininiw Education Resource Centre in Norway House, a remote First Nations community in Manitoba, Canada.The documentary showcases the progressive efforts of the Norway House Cree Nation to revitalize their Indigenous culture and education system. "Rhymes for Young Ghouls" is a Canadian drama film released in 2013, directed by Jeff Barnaby. The movie is set in the 1970s on the Red Crow Mi'gMaq reservation in Canada and explores the impact of the Canadian government's policy of forcing Indigenous children to attend residential schools.The story follows a teenage girl named Aila, who is dealing with the trauma of losing her mother and brother to a tragic accident.
